Suburb profile

Set among the hills of George Town, Mount Direction is a smaller community with bushland views and a cooler, leafier feel. Set in the wider countryside, it offers distance from the capital and a strong sense of place. Ridge-top pockets and tree cover give the area a cooler, greener hillside feel.

Established families and long-term residents give the suburb a settled feel, with a strong presence of young families throughout. The pace is unhurried, with local businesses and community spots doing the heavy lifting. Housing is well-priced for what you get: space, location and everyday convenience.

The streetscape feels settled and established, with older homes giving the area a familiar, lived-in look.

On the desirability index, the suburb sits below average overall, mainly because local dining and lifestyle amenities and parks and green space lag similar regional towns, despite relative strength in housing affordability. Limited access to some essential local services also trimmed the result.
